M-171 Aesthetic Refresher Course

Level: Intermediate
Length: 4 Hours

Instructor: Patricia A. Owens, RN, MHA, CMLSO

Course Credits: Attendees are eligible for 4 AAHP CE Credits, 4 CEU's Awarded by ONA

This offering has been approved by the Ohio Board of Nursing through the OBN approver unit at the Health Alliance. (OBN-007-92).

This 4 hour course has been developed for the clinician responsible for the aesthetic practices and/or the Laser Safety Officer (LSO) duties in an aesthetic environment. This refresher course provides a technical update in the areas of aesthetic safety standards, clinical applications, and new technology. The curriculum has been developed in accordance with the ANSI Z136.3-2011 standard, for Safe Use of Lasers in Health Care. This course has been approved to meet the requirements as dictated in Texas House bill 449 and 25 Texas Administrative Code 289.302 and 301.

Note: Students must bring a current copy of the ANSI Z136.3 Standard. If you need to purchase a current copy, they will be available at the course for $163.00, or they may be purchased online ahead of time.
